Weight loss is not just about shedding pounds; it’s a transformative journey that requires patience and commitment. In the initial phase (Weeks 1-2), noticeable changes often include reduced bloating and water retention. Many may see a minor scale drop, but this is commonly due to water weight loss, not fat loss. As you progress into Weeks 2-4, you’ll likely notice your clothes fitting more comfortably, and comments from friends and family can provide motivation. By Weeks 6-8, physical transformations become increasingly apparent as you lose weight and tone muscles. Finally, by Weeks 8-12, expect to see significant muscle definition and body shape changes. Celebrate every stage of this journey and remember that consistency is key to long-term success. 💪🏽
